The big irony, of course, is that statistically all the major violent crimes are WAY down, to the lowest points they've been at in decades. That, and the big boogey-man fears that people carry around (child abduction, home invasion, etc.) are so statistically small as to not even really exist, at least as far as scary strangers *out there* are concerned. One certainty though is that raising a child to not take the slightest risks and to grow up normalized to being joined at Mommy's hip will create a dependent, easily cracked pseudo-adult.
